In the fast-paced and competitive business environment of Asia, maintaining a positive and productive work culture is crucial for success. Unfortunately, workplace misconduct and conflict can arise, affecting not only employee morale but also the company’s reputation and bottom line. As an HR professional in Asia, it’s essential to have a solid plan in place to investigate and address these issues effectively. Here are six critical components of a comprehensive human resources investigation template, tailored specifically for Asian businesses:
1. Incident Reporting Form
Develop a standard incident reporting form that outlines the details of the incident, including the date, time, location, and involved parties. This form serves as the initial documentation of the incident and helps ensure that relevant details are captured promptly. Make sure to include guidelines on how to fill out the form and where to submit it. For example:
Incident Type: _______________________________
Date and Time: ______________________________
Location: __________________________________
Involved Parties: _______________________________
2. Investigation Purpose and Scope
Clearly define the purpose and scope of the investigation. Determine the specific areas of focus, such as employee misconduct, conflict, or workplace safety issues. Establish the boundaries of the investigation to avoid overstepping or under-investigating the situation. Consider the following:
* Purpose: To investigate the incident and identify the root cause.
* Scope: To cover relevant parties, locations, and time periods.
3. Investigator Selection and Training
Choose investigators who are objective, impartial, and trained to handle sensitive situations. Ensure they understand the company’s policies, procedures, and cultural expectations. Training may include:
* Understanding workplace investigation laws and regulations
* Conducting effective interviews and collecting evidence
* Maintaining a neutral and respectful attitude
4. Witness Interviews
Prepare a comprehensive list of potential witnesses and conduct thorough interviews. Ensure witnesses understand the investigation’s purpose and their role in it. Consider the following:
* Prepare a detailed interview guide.
* Ensure witnesses are aware of their rights and responsibilities.
* Take detailed notes and record conversations, if necessary.
5. Evidence Collection and Management
Implement a systematic approach to collecting and managing evidence, including documents, emails, photos, and physical items. Consider the following:
* Develop a clear evidence collection plan.
* Establish a secure and confidential storage system.
* Follow chain-of-custody protocols for physical evidence.

7. Cultural Considerations
Recognize the cultural nuances of your Asian workforce and adapt the investigation process accordingly. Be sensitive to power dynamics, collectivism, and group harmony. Consider the following:
* Familiarize yourself with regional cultural practices and sensitivities.
* Ensure open communication channels and respect employee rights.
* Use culturally appropriate language and terminology.
8. Investigation Report and Follow-up
Determine the format and content of the investigation report, including findings, recommendations, and any disciplinary actions. Ensure all parties involved are informed and follow up on the report’s implementation. Consider the following:
* Prepare a comprehensive report outlining the investigation’s findings.
* Identify and implement recommendations.
* Monitor progress and follow up with affected parties.
9. Record Keeping and Compliance
Maintain accurate and up-to-date records of the investigation, including documentation, minutes, and reports. Ensure compliance with labor laws, regulations, and company policies. Consider the following:
* Establish a centralized filing system for investigation records.
* Store records securely and confidentially.
* Review and update records as necessary to ensure compliance.
10. Ongoing Review and Improvement
Regularly review and refine the HR investigation template to ensure it remains effective and compliant with changing laws, regulations, and cultural norms. Consider the following:
* Review investigation reports and identify areas for improvement.
* Seek feedback from employees and stakeholders.
* Update policies and procedures as needed to ensure a positive and productive work environment.
By incorporating these essential components into your HR investigation template, you’ll be better equipped to address workplace misconduct and conflict in a fair, transparent, and culturally sensitive manner.
